Oil type release agent for metal casting, spray method, and electrostatic spray apparatus |
摘要 |
There is disclosed an oil type release agent for metal casting includes 0-7.5% by mass of water consisting of one or two kinds of water selected from distilled water, ion-exchange kinds of water, tap water and water includes any one of aforementioned kinds of water and electrolyte(s) dissolved in any one of aforementioned kinds of water, and 0.3-30% by mass of a solubilizing agent, a spray method using the oil type release agent, and an electrostatic spray apparatus. |

主权项 |
1. A release composition for metal casting, comprising:
0.2-7.5% by weight of the total composition of water consisting of one or two kinds of water selected from distilled water, ion-exchanged water, tap water and water comprising any one of the aforementioned kinds of water and electrolyte(s) dissolved therein; 0.3-30% by weight of the total composition of a solubilizing agent; and an oil type release agent, constituting the rest of the composition, wherein the oil type release agent is WFR-3R and including:
(a) about 89 parts by weight of a solvent having dynamic viscosity of 2 to 10 mm2/s at 40° C. and a flash point in the range of 70 to 170° C.,(b) about 5 parts by weight of a high viscosity mineral oil and/or synthetic oil having dynamic viscosity of 100 mm2/s or higher at 40° C.,(c) about 5 parts by weight of a silicone oil having dynamic viscosity of 150 mm2/s or higher at 40° C.,(d) about 0.5 parts by weight of a rapeseed oil; and(e) about 0.5 parts by weight of organic molybdenum, wherein the oil type release agent has a flash point in the range of 70 to 170° C. and dynamic viscosity of 2 to 30 mm2/s or higher at 40° C. |
